The Science Behind Induction Speed
Induction technology bypasses the inefficient middleman of thermal transfer. Instead of heating a burner that then heats a pan that finally heats your food, induction uses electromagnetic fields to excite the molecules directly within your cookware itself. This fundamental difference means water boils in under 90 seconds, and a cold pan reaches searing temperature almost instantaneously. For weeknight warriors, this translates to getting pasta water rolling while you chop vegetables, or searing chicken breasts without a 5-minute preheat delay. The 2026 models have refined this technology with more precise frequency modulation, reducing the slight pulsing effect older models exhibited at low temperatures and delivering buttery-smooth simmer control.
Energy Efficiency Meets Culinary Precision
Beyond raw speed, induction ranges channel up to 90% of their energy directly into your food—compared to roughly 40% for gas and 50% for traditional electric. This efficiency isn’t just eco-friendly; it’s wallet-friendly and kitchen-comfort friendly. Your cooking zone cools down within seconds of removing the pan, meaning less ambient heat sweatily accumulating while you’re trying to plate dinner. The precision is surgical: you can hold chocolate at 115°F for delicate tempering without a double boiler, or drop from a rolling boil to a bare simmer with a single touch. For weeknight meals, this means fewer ruined sauces, perfectly executed one-pot dishes, and the confidence to attempt more ambitious recipes on a time budget.

Rapid Preheat and True Convection Systems
The oven component of your induction range should pull its own weight in the speed department. 2026 rapid preheat systems use dual-element configurations that cycle intelligently to reach 350°F in under 6 minutes without blasting the broiler element (which can scorch enamel). True convection means a third heating element behind the fan, not just a fan circulating hot air. This distinction matters for weeknight baking—true convection eliminates the need to rotate trays and reduces cooking times by 15-25%. Look for ranges with European-style convection that reverses fan direction periodically, ensuring even browning on multi-rack bakes.

Ventilation Solutions for Induction Cooking
While induction produces less ambient heat than gas, it still generates steam, smoke, and cooking odors that require proper ventilation. The good news: because you’re not dealing with combustion byproducts, you can often downsize your CFM (cubic feet per minute) requirements by 30-50%. A 300-400 CFM range hood typically suffices for induction, compared to 600+ CFM for gas. Downdraft ventilation integrated into the cooktop has improved dramatically in 2026, with quieter operation and better capture efficiency. For island installations, consider ceiling-mounted recirculating systems with advanced charcoal filters—they’re now effective enough for serious cooking and avoid complex ductwork.
Cookware Compatibility: What Works and What Doesn’t
The Magnet Test Explained
The internet’s favorite induction compatibility test—slap a magnet on the bottom—remains valid but incomplete. A magnet must stick firmly, but that’s just the starting point. 2026 induction ranges feature more sensitive coils that can work with slightly magnetic materials, but performance suffers. The real test is the “drag test”: if a magnet requires noticeable force to slide across the pan’s base, you’ve got excellent induction material. If it skids easily, the pan will heat unevenly and slowly. Also check for flatness: place a straightedge across the bottom; any gap larger than a credit card thickness will create inefficient hot spots and buzzing.
Best Materials for Induction Performance
Cast iron and carbon steel remain induction champions, offering superior heat retention for searing. However, they’re slow to respond to temperature changes—ironically countering induction’s speed advantage. For weeknight agility, multi-ply stainless steel with a thick magnetic base provides the sweet spot: fast response, even heating, and dishwasher durability. New “induction-ready” copper and aluminum pans feature bonded steel plates that perform admirably, though they command premium prices. Avoid ceramic and glass cookware unless explicitly labeled induction-compatible; even then, test them first as many brands overpromise. Enameled cast iron works beautifully but can scratch glass cooktops—always lift, never slide.
When to Replace Your Existing Cookware
Don’t automatically discard your entire cookware collection. Audit each piece: keep anything that passes the magnet test with flying colors. For marginal pieces (weak magnet attraction), try them on a friend’s induction range or at a showroom before deciding. Budget for replacing about 60-70% of your collection—most people find their non-stick frying pans and lightweight saucepans are incompatible. Consider this an opportunity: induction’s precision makes it the perfect excuse to upgrade to clad stainless steel, which will outlast three generations of non-stick pans. Pro tip: buy one high-quality 12-inch skillet and a 3-quart saucepan first; these handle 80% of weeknight tasks.

Dealing with Spills and Burnt-On Residue
Even with induction, accidents happen. Sugar spills are the arch-nemesis—if you spill caramel or jam, immediately turn off the zone and scrape up the bulk with a plastic scraper while it’s still warm (but not hot). Once cooled, a ceramic cooktop polish with a mild abrasive can remove the residue without scratching. For the oven, remove racks and soak them in hot soapy water while running a steam clean cycle. Burnt-on cheese or casseroles? Create a paste of baking soda and water, spread it on the cooled spill, let it sit for 20 minutes, then scrub gently with a non-scratch sponge. Never use oven cleaner on a self-cleaning oven; the chemicals damage the special coating.

BTU Equivalents and Wattage Ratings
Manufacturers love touting “equivalent to 20,000 BTU,” but wattage tells the real story. A 3,600-watt burner equals roughly 12,000 BTU—plenty for most tasks. The 2026 breakthrough is sustained wattage: cheap models might hit 3,600 watts for 30 seconds then throttle to 2,400, while premium units maintain peak power for 10+ minutes. For weeknight speed, look for minimum 3,000 watts per large burner and sustained boost capability. Don’t obsess over the total range wattage; power distribution matters more. A range with four 2,500-watt burners cooks slower than one with two 3,600-watt burners and two 1,800-watt burners, as you can’t use maximum power on all zones simultaneously anyway.

Troubleshooting Common Induction Concerns
Buzzing and Humming: What’s Normal?
That concerning hum is usually the pan, not the range. Multi-ply cookware with thin layers can vibrate at the induction frequency, creating a buzz that varies with power level. This is normal and harmless, though annoying. To minimize it, ensure pan bottoms are perfectly flat and use lower power settings for tasks that don’t demand maximum heat. If the range itself is buzzing loudly, especially at low settings, this indicates a failing capacitor or loose coil—service is required. 2026 models have improved coil mounting and damping materials, making genuine range defects rare but not impossible.
